P353 JOK is a 1996 Rover 620 in Green with a 1,997cc petrol engine. This vehicle has been through 16 MOT tests with a personal pass rate of 56.3%.
Across all 1996 Rover 620 models, the average MOT pass rate is 62.5% with a typical mileage of 105,901 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Rover 620 fails its MOT is parking brake: efficiency below requirements, accounting for 54,795 recorded failures. If you're considering buying P353 JOK, it's worth having these areas checked by a mechanic before committing.
The Rover 620 typically stays on UK roads for around 33 years. At 30 years old, this Rover 620 is approaching the upper end of the typical lifespan for this model.
